I have seen a number of Tyler Perry’s movies and they are usually entertaining, but a little over the top, even the dramas. However, his newest release on Netflix, “A Jazzman’s Blues” is his best film to date. It tells the story of a black singer from Georgia and his unrequited love. Newcomer Joshua Boone plays the Jazzman and he is quite a find. The rest of the cast is also excellent. The story is about a young man who loves a girl who passes for white. There are a number of twists and turns and the ending packs a wallop. As usual Perry includes characters that are really bad and ones that are virtuous. The music and dancing are outstanding. I loved this movie and recommend that anyone who likes a good story with good acting see it.
